- Nan replies to sue| 3 repliesVery sneaky and dishonest. The call themselves the Telephone PROTECTION Service so that they can say they are the TPS without breaking the law. They hope to fool people into thinking that TPS is not a free service, which the real TPS is, and getting them to pay for a service which does not exist. They cannot, of course stop ALL nuisance calls and do not know how many, if any, calls you have been getting. As you say, they cannot see the irony of making a nuisance call offering to stop nuisance calls!

- Reg| 1 replyReceived call from a gentleman named Kerry who sounded very plausible and gave me a number 08719891414 which upon looking it up on Google and this site drew a blank so suspicion became aroused but I let him carry on with his sales patter. . He claimed to be from Telecom Protection Service and said that they understood that I was received an abundance of unwanted calls - which I have. He offered me a service which would block such calls for a fee of 50p per month for three years subscription but I had to pay £79 upfront for a gadget to attach to my phone. I asked him where he had got the information revealing that I had received numerous calls and he replied that it was from a general survey of the area where I live. I immediately declined his kind offer and suggested that he was part of a scam and possibly in collusion with the people who make the annoying calls. At this point he became a bit annoyed and this deepened when I said that I will be reporting the matter to Trading Standards supplying them them a number which I believed to be non-existent and any number that I obtain from dialing 1471. The number obtained after dialing 1471 was 02030045597..
